Quote:
Originally Posted by avalonandl View Post
Why do you want 2" headers. Unless you are making north of 650 to 700 hp you really don't need them. 1 7/8 is fine.
Most of the reputable tuners have confirmed 2" make more power and typically lose bothing down low on these LT1s. Why wouldn't you go with 2", more power even at the bolt on level, and will pay dividends later on if going H/C or FI. Just make sure the fit and quality is up to par.

Those are their Chinese versions. I had SW headers on my 15 GT back before the pricing was crazy. I didn’t dislike my Texas Speed Chinese headers, just looking into all options. And yes, the 2” vs 1 7/8” debate goes on. Many have tested them back to back and proven the 2” make more up top and lose nothing to the smaller headers down low. This engine moves a lot of air.
